Special Conditions for -2- <br />ENCROACHMENT PERMIT <br />13. Shoulder backing shall be backed with Class II Aggregate Base from edge of pavement a <br />minimum of 4 -inches thick by 4 -foot wide. <br />14. School buses shall be passed through the work zone with minimal delays. <br />15. Above ground ARV boxes and other similar facilities will be allowed within the right-of-way if <br />located as far to the outside edge as possible and if the location either meets AASHTO Clear <br />Zone guidelines or is protected by an existing obstruction such as a tree or utility pole. Utility <br />vaults shall be located a minimum of 4'-0" from edge of pavement. <br />16. County roads shall be kept clean from mud and debris at all times along the access points and <br />work zone areas during entire project. All standard roadway striping and signage shall be clearly <br />visible, maintained and restored throughout the construction zone during and after the project. <br />17. In addition to standard dust control measures, streets shall be maintained in a clean condition, <br />free of dirt, mud and debris during construction activities. The contractor shall provide daily, or as <br />needed, street sweeping using a modern mechanical or vacuum -assisted street sweeper. <br />18. The contractor shall not conduct construction operations in rain or heavy fog conditions. <br />19. Need a minimum of 10' lanes. <br />
